NN Group: profit down on private equity, reinsurance

(CercleFinance.com) - Dutch insurer NN Group said that its third-quarter operating profit fell to 453 million euros, from 463 million euros a year ago, mainly due to lower private equity earnings and a lower result at its reinsurance business.


Netherlands non-life posted a good result, as did banking, insurance in Europe, and life in Japan, while special dividends at Netherlands life were lower than a year ago, the company said.

The insurer said that it reached further cost reductions of 17 million euros in the third quarter, bringing total cost reductions achieved to date to 323 million euros versus its full-year 2016 cost base.

NN's capital ratio under Europe's Solvency II rules rose to 217%, from 210% a year ago, reflecting the impact of operating capital generation.

Net profit fell to 515 million euros, from 788 million euros last year, mainly reflecting lower non-operating items.

The shares are currently up 1.4% in Amsterdam.
